¿Dónde encontrar el código fuente de un widget?
Me gustaría encontrar el código fuente de los widgets, ¿sabrían dónde encontrarlos? He encontrado la clase WP_Widget, pero me gustaría encontrar, por ejemplo, el widget con los últimos artículos.
Gracias

Los widgets por defecto están definidos en wp-includes/default-widgets.php
.
Para encontrar código específico, busca en el Codex o usa queryposts.com. La mejor herramienta es tu IDE (entorno de desarrollo integrado). Todos los IDEs ofrecen una búsqueda de texto completo en un conjunto de archivos.
Aquí una captura de pantalla de Eclipse PDT
Como puedes ver, es realmente flexible – y también rápido. Consulta también esta pregunta para una guía básica sobre cómo trabajar con WordPress en un IDE.

otro enlace para encontrar el código fuente de las funciones de WordPress: http://phpxref.ftwr.co.uk/wordpress/nav.html?_functions/index.html

Los widgets pueden provenir de cualquier cantidad de fuentes: plugins, temas o el núcleo mismo. Por lo tanto, encontrar el código de un widget específico podría resultar problemático si no se conoce su origen. Podrías buscarlo usando grep
con fragmentos que conozcas, o buscar todos los widgets usando extends WP_Widget
. Si sabes de dónde proviene (núcleo, plugin, etc.), es tan simple como revisar (o usar grep
, supongo) a través del código.
